My Artist Bio By Jimmie Rarick Alissa Miller was born in Seoul, Korea on June 9, 1977. She was adopted into the United States at the age of six months and lived in Florida before moving to Columbus, Ohio. She tried many different mediums and styles, but fell in love with oils and surrealism. Her love of surrealism stems from her compulsive daydreaming and admiration of Salvador Dali’s great works. Alissa’s work displays her vivid imagination and skillful interpretation of the world and people around her. Much like Dali’s work, Alissa’s art provokes thought, imagination and sparks conversation, if not sometimes controversy. Her passion for her work is prevalent in all her pieces and imbues them with a life all their own. "I have Dalínian thought: the one thing the world will never have enough of is the outrageous." ---Salvador Dali My Artist Statement: By Alissa Miller My work portrays a compilation of ideas in a surrealist composition. A compulsive daydreamer, painter, creator of images to inspire and entertain. To provoke random acts of thought through a simplistic form of oil on canvas.
